The trainer

Alex Rothacker

Alex started training dogs at 16 and never stopped. More than 50+ years later he owns TOPS Kennel in Grayslake, Illinois, where he runs the six-week programs that have put hundreds of police K9s on the street across the Chicago area.

He learned from the late Willie Necker, whose dogs performed on The Ed Sullivan Show, and he has carried that showmanship forward: Alex and his dogs have set more than 30+ Guinness World Records and appeared on national television for decades.

His method is simple and stubborn: consistency, praise, and tiny steps. No force. He has taken shelter dogs scheduled for euthanasia and turned them into performers. The same approach works on a police dog, a record-holder, and the puppy chewing your shoe right now.

The star

Pappy the Poodle

Pappy is a three-year-old white poodle from Chicago who walks on his hind legs — across Michigan Avenue, into the NBC Chicago studio, and up flights of stairs. Alex started working with him at three months old after noticing how much Pappy loved an audience: the more people clapped, the taller he stood.

He holds Guinness World Records for walking backward and climbing stairs on two legs, and he has charmed audiences on The Kelly Clarkson Show, NewsNation, WGN, and NBC. Millions follow him at @pappythepoodle.

Every trick Pappy knows was built the same way you'll learn in these courses — lure, mark, reward, repeat — a few minutes at a time.
